Transaction 2fa3dea100756a857d4051a280bc604dc48eb41ff0e5c8afacff933627353ab7

1 Input
2 Outputs
  • 2fa3dea100756a857d4051a280bc604dc48eb41ff0e5c8afacff933627353ab7:0
  • value  865327111
    address  38Lu8HJdo6VpbBHQrHXgNQJeoJyGrimXES
  • 2fa3dea100756a857d4051a280bc604dc48eb41ff0e5c8afacff933627353ab7:1
  • value  1185947
    address  12oi5ruS5s5bozT1vpCHWskeLzyid8o12V